View my store BetaYeah I kinda forgot about that one, but blowing out the Bengals at home and going into New England to face the Pats is two different things. The Bengals were in what, their third playoff game in like 20 years or so? Just not the same thing.
I don't hate the Texans or anything, I just think that they have gotten hyped and been overrated because of a super easy schedule. Sure they deserve some credit for going 12-4, but logic dictates that you take it with a grain of salt. How good does a team have to be to start the season 11-1 when the bulk of those games are against teams like the Dolphins, Jaguars, Jets, Titans and Bills? I just think that the real Texans are the team that lost 3 of their final 4 games to playoff caliber teams and I think the fact that they barely sqeaked out a win over the Bengals last week shows it.
All you have to do is look at who they beat.
vs. playoff teams 3-4
vs. non-playoff teams 9-0Last edited by duane1969; 01-09-2013 at 08:40 AM.
